Saint Barbara is known in the Eastern Orthodox Church as the Great Martyr Barbara. She was an early Christian saint and martyr. There is no reference to her in the authentic early Christian writings nor in the original recension of St. Jerome's martyrology. St. Barbara Feast Day is celebrated on the 4th of December. The name of the saint can be traced back to the 7th century. Veneration of her was common from the 9th century.


She was often portrayed with miniature chains and a tower.
